Well friends, it’s time to say goodbye.

After much time and consideration, it is with heavy hearts that we have made the difficult decision to close the bakery, with our final day of service being Thursday, April 27th.

Please know that this has been a heartbreaking decision, but is ultimately the best choice for us and our family. The last five years of business ownership have been filled with fantastic highs and learning opportunities, alongside unprecedented challenges and health crises, both public and personal.

While the business did well and we have been very lucky to have made it through the pandemic, our priorities have shifted to focus on our personal health and wellness, which we have been sacrificing in many ways over the past five years.

We have treasured the opportunity to be a part of this community and grow as both people and bakers, and are forever grateful to each and every person who has supported us over the years. We were hopeful to pass this established business on to another driven entrepreneur, to give someone the opportunity like we were given all those years ago, but it just wasn’t in the cards.
